Dr. Caswell specializes in elections and political participation, urban and state politics, and American political thought. Prior to Glassboro/Rowan in 1989, Dr. Caswell taught at Temple University, Rutgers University - Camden, and the University of Pennsylvania. He has also held positions as Research Director, Institute for the Study of Civic Values, a nonprofit education and research foundation, and as urban planner, policy analyst, and intergovernmental relations specialist with the Office of the Secretary, U.S. Department of Health, Education, and Welfare. Dr. Caswell is currently President of the Rowan University Senate. Dr. Caswell, has degrees from the University of Chicago (A.B., Sociology), the University of Pennsylvania (M.C.P., City Planning), and Rutgers University (Ph.D., Political Science), and was a New Jersey Faculty Fellow at Princeton University.
